Is there a keyboard shortcut for Undo? Yes. To Undo an action in a Windows application, use the Ctrl+Z keyboard shortcut. Press and hold the ‘Ctrl’ key and then press the ‘Z’ key. Once the changes are undone, release both keys. Keep pressing and releasing Ctrl+Z to undo multipl...
